CHANGES TO APPENDICES. 6.1. The Parties agree to review Appendices attached to this Agreement annually and as necessary to make required adjustments to Buyer’s supply services. Such changes shall be consistent with the Agreement terms. Such changes also will be consistent with Section 3.4 (2) of the Settlement, which provides for possible adjustments in delivery services on an annual basis for the term of the Settlement. The annual, monthly, and daily deliverability of Buyer’s Appendix Services will be designed to most effectively match Buyer’s overall sendout requirements. 6.2. Pursuant to the Commission’s Policy Governing the Filing of Affiliate Contracts adopted by the Commission March 3, 2010 in GAO2010-1, adjustments to the Agreement are not effective until filed with the Commission. Therefore, the Parties agree to modify and execute Appendices 30 days prior to their effective date to be consistent with Section 3.1 of the Settlement and file with the Commission prior to the effective date, consistent with GAO2010-1. 6.3. Each year Buyer shall timely submit to Seller peak day and annual demand data for both a normal and severe season plan in a monthly baseload and usage per degree day format. The foregoing information is critical to Seller’s role of optimizing Buyer’s portfolio, assisting in the determination of the most efficient set of Appendix Services for Buyer, and meeting the requirements of GAO2010-1.
